What Is A Camera Stabilizer?

A camera stabilizer is a device that helps keep your photos and videos steady. It attaches to the front of your camera and uses gravity or a counterweight to keep the camera in one spot, allowing you to take steadier shots. Some stabilizers also have motors that help keep the camera stable while capturing video or photos.

Benefits of a Camera Stabilizer

If you’re serious about photography, then a camera stabilizer is an essential piece of equipment. Here are just some of the benefits:

  1. Stability: A camera stabilizer helps to keep your photos and videos stable, even when shooting in low light or unstable conditions. This can help prevent blurry or jittery pictures and make it much easier to capture smooth, professional-looking videos.
  2. Increased Accuracy: A camera stabilizer also helps to improve your accuracy when taking pictures and videos. By reducing the amount of camera shake, you’ll be able to capture sharper images and smoother videos that look more professional.
  3. Increased Speed and Efficiency: A camera stabilizer can also speed up your shooting process by helping to reduce the amount of time it takes to take a picture or video. This can help you save precious time while shooting photos or recording videos, making all the difference in efficiency and quality.
